From My Mama's Kitchen Talk Radio  

From My Mama’s Kitchen Talk Radio is based on the book - From My Mama’s Kitchen – “food for the soul, recipes for living” by Johnny Tan. Originally intended as a cookbook to preserve his moms’ recipes, transpires into a motherly love-inspired book about his personal relationships with his adopted mom in Malaysia and with eight other wonderful women whom he refers to as “mom” in the United States. Over the years,his mothers were his “team of counselors”who provided him unconditional motherly-love. They were always available whenever he needed them – to talk, get some advice or just to sound off. This weekly talk show hosted by the author, Johnny Tan, pays tribute and honors his moms and moms everywhere for their timeless loving wisdom, spiritual and inspirational contribution in making a positive difference in the lives of their children and their loved ones. It provides a platform for everyone to share their own experiences of “motherly love” on-air with other listeners. With the support of special guests, Johnny’s vision and mission is to educate, entertain, and inspire everyone the significant role mothers’ play in our daily lives and to bring “motherly love” to center stage.     Blended Family - Unconditional Motherly Love - If there is a will, there is a way!

    Remarried With Children: The new family dynamic! - My Last Show - For My Mother's Day Special Series for the month of May.

    It’s wonderful to see successfully married couples raising their children.  But the nuclear family as we know it is disappearing, giving way to blended families that are combinations of adults and children from previous families. 

    An estimated one-in-three Americans are part of a blended family, and that’s expected to climb to 50% for Americans during their lifetime.

    About 75% of divorced persons will remarry, and 65% of those remarriages will include children from prior marriages.

    In fact, by 2010, blended families are projected to be the predominant family form in the United States.

    Helping us keep step with how these families form and function is Shirley Cress Dudley,  a Licensed Professional Counselor from Charlotte, North Carolina, with master’s degrees in both  marriage and family counseling  and education.

    In addition to her practice, Shirley, along with her husband Eric, is blended family with five children.
